Common Dos and Donuts:
-
Donut use any old rubber band
just to keep hair off the face. Rubber bands tend to break or split hair.
Instead just use a scrunchy or a fabric coated elastic band.
-
Donut brush wet hair too harshly
because its three times weaker and more likely to break off mid strand.
Towel dry hair first, then gently detangle using a wide tooth comb.
-
Donut sud up more than once
unless your hair is extremely greasy else it'll become too dry and frizzy.
Oil hair before every wash. Massage oil well into the scalp and keep for
a minimum of half-hour. This keeps your scalp nourished and conditioned.
